Understanding Endpoint Connections in Forecast Management
Endpoint connections serve as the direct pathways that link desktop tools or automated scripts to blog databases, and they operate by accepting authenticated calls that carry structured forecast data such as odds, team selections, and stake recommendations. According to industry reports from research institutions in North America and Europe, these connections process thousands of updates daily on popular blogging systems, which means credential validation happens at each request to confirm the source before content appears publicly. Those who manage such systems often configure role-based permissions so that credentials grant limited rights focused only on specific post types rather than full site control.
Blog platforms integrate these endpoints through standard protocols that accept XML or JSON payloads, and this allows forecast authors to draft material offline before transmitting it in batches. Data from academic studies on content management security indicates that proper endpoint configuration prevents unauthorized modifications, since each call must include valid credential tokens that expire after set intervals. Experts have observed that teams handling accumulator forecasts benefit when endpoints log every transaction, creating audit trails that track who added or revised particular predictions at exact times.
Role of Admin Credentials in Secure Workflows
Admin credentials act as the initial verification layer that unlocks endpoint access, and they typically combine usernames with encrypted passwords or token-based systems to establish identity before any data exchange begins. Figures from technology oversight bodies in Australia and Canada reveal that sites using multi-factor authentication alongside basic credentials experience fewer unauthorized entry attempts, which proves especially relevant for platforms publishing time-sensitive betting forecasts. People who oversee these systems frequently rotate credentials on scheduled cycles to limit exposure windows if any single token becomes compromised.
Once validated, credentials permit targeted operations such as creating new posts, editing existing forecasts, or scheduling publication times through the connected endpoints. Research indicates that granular permission sets tied to these credentials stop users from accessing unrelated areas of the blog, thereby containing potential issues to forecast-specific sections only. In practice, teams assign separate credential sets for different contributors so that one author cannot alter another's material without additional approval steps.

Implementation Practices on Common Blog Platforms
Many blog platforms support endpoint connections through built-in APIs that require credential headers in every request, and administrators set these up by generating application-specific passwords or OAuth tokens rather than sharing main account details. Studies conducted by European research groups highlight that platforms configured this way maintain uptime during peak traffic periods because endpoints handle authentication independently from the main user interface. Content teams often test connections in staging environments first to verify that forecast data formats match platform requirements before live deployment.
Security protocols recommend storing credentials in encrypted vaults instead of hard-coding them into scripts, and this practice reduces accidental leaks during code reviews or shared repository access. According to reports issued by government technology agencies in the United States, organizations that enforce regular credential audits detect outdated tokens more quickly and replace them before they create vulnerabilities. Those managing accumulator forecast sites apply the same standards because publication schedules depend on reliable, secure connections that do not fail mid-update.
Security Considerations and Monitoring
Monitoring tools track endpoint activity by logging successful and failed credential attempts, which provides early warnings when unusual patterns emerge such as repeated access from unfamiliar locations. Industry analyses from Asia-Pacific research centers show that combining credential monitoring with rate limiting prevents brute-force attempts from overwhelming the system during high-stakes periods like major sporting events. Administrators review these logs regularly to adjust permission levels or revoke access for former team members.
Encryption standards applied to both credential transmission and stored forecast data add another protection layer, and platforms enforce HTTPS for all endpoint traffic as a baseline requirement. Observers note that in August 2026 many sites also implement IP whitelisting so that only approved addresses can initiate connections, which narrows the attack surface further. Teams document every configuration change to maintain consistency across multiple blogs that publish similar forecast content.
